
Louis-Charles Damais
Louis-Charles Damais (1911-1966) was a French epigrapher and researcher renowned for his meticulous study of ancient inscriptions in Indonesia and India. His extensive cataloging of numeral symbols significantly advanced the understanding of historical numeral systems and contributed to the scholarship on the cultural exchanges between India and Southeast Asia.
